1. Fail, Not Completed or Not Assessed

You can apply to resit modules which have outcomes of Fail (F), Not Completed (NC) or Not Assessed (NA)and pay online by following instructions a-c.

a) Check your results statement (available online during July 2012) for details of the modules that you need to apply to resit.

b) Calculate the amount you need to pay using the table below. No fee is required where the result is NA (Not Assessed).

2. Pass Conceded (JULY/AUGUST ONLY)

If your level/year result is PC (Pass Conceded) you may proceed to the next level of your programme even though you have failed one or more modules. Please seek advice from your academic department before applying.

3. Repeat Year

If you intend to REPEAT the year, with attendance during 2011/12, you will need to complete a ‘Change of Status’ form

If you wish only to submit work and/or attend the exam for modules with outcomes of Fail (F), Not Completed (NC) or Not Assessed (NA) as an EXTERNAL candidate you can apply and pay on-line following the instructions in section 1 above.

It is assumed that you will resit all modules which have outcomes of Fail (F), Not Completed (NC) or Not Assessed (NA). If, for some reason, your academic department has agreed that you are not required to resit a specific failed module you must notify Registry Services, Level 6, University House immediately, by producing written supporting evidence obtained from your department.

If you are an International Student with a valid visa, please seek advice from International Student Services before applying to register as an external student.
